I do think that most sororities would fill up their pledge classes as soon as they can (at least we always did), so that the pledge class can have some unity instead of new members always going through.
That being said, things can vary from school to school. Who knows, maybe some chapters through you already got a bid.
They know you're interested as you put your interest out there for COB. It's kinda like dating.... as mom always said, if he likes you, he'll call. You've showed your interest, now it's up to them to make a move.
DO NOT DO NOT DO NOT STALK ANY GROUPS ON CAMPUS! Calling/IMing members, stopping them on campus, etc. is a great way to make sure you don't get a bid ever. If you mention your interest in casual conversation with a member you know, that's fine. But being a pest is a surefire way to get on someone's bad side.
Also practice discretion, especially on GC. Things you say, and have said, can easily come out and bite you in the ass, bigtime. It's happened before, it'll happen again.
